个人简介

柳佳林,湖北黄冈人,中共党员,分别于2016年和2019年在华中科技大学获得学士和硕士学位,2023年在香港城市大学获得博士学位,2023年9月至2024年3月在香港理工大学从事博后研究,2024年3月至今,入职bw必威西汉姆联,加入玄武岩纤维生产及应用技术国家地方联合工程研究中心团队,担任副研究员(专任教师),硕士导师 。



学术兼职

担任中文EI期刊《复合材料学报》青年编委、ISO/TC 71/SC 6国内技术对口工作组委员、SCI期刊Nanomaterials客座编辑。
